Context of Kidnapping and Survival

Colleen Stan’s case is often described as a prolonged kidnapping in which she was held in a hidden underground room. The images that circulate from this period are typically from police evidence, news photography, and later documentary projects that recreate her experience. Understanding the context helps readers interpret any photo with sensitivity toward her trauma.

During her captivity, law enforcement documented physical evidence, and photo records became part of the legal file. Following her rescue, these images were selectively released to the press, shaping public perception of the case and its severity.
